Experiencing Haridwar from Your Holiday Home

By staying in a holiday home feel Haridwar differently. Some of the activities that you can get involved with are/can

1. Attend the Ganga Aarti

The Ganga Aarti at Har Ki Pauri is a definite tick-mark. This daily ritual involves chanting and prayers while floating lamps on the river, creating a magical and spiritually lifting ambiance. It’s such a beautiful experience that you can’t afford to miss, which is carried out every evening.

2. Explore Local Temples

Haridwar has numerous ancient temples. A visit to the famous Mansa Devi and Chandi Devi temples, which are located on top of a hill, will fulfill the spiritual quotient within you and also offer a panoramic view of the city and river.

3. Take a Dip in the Ganges

The dip is considered purifying to the soul in the holy Ganges. Many Ghats(steps going to the river) in Haridwar allow you to take a dip in the holy Ganges. It’s a profound experience, especially in the early morning hours.

4. Nature Walks

Haridwar is deeply set in the lap of nature. Spend some lovely time with walks along the river, strolls at Rajaji National Park, or hikes around the nearest viewpoint. The area provides ample space for nature lovers.

5. Local Cuisine Experience

One of its advantages is the availability for you to cook a meal of your taste, at your convenience. Or you can always experiment with street food. Indulge in some sweetmeats from the local confectioners or in local street foods famous in Haridwar, including kachoris, jalebis, aloo puri, and so on.

Exploring Haridwar’s Surroundings

While much is there within the city, no place outside the city disappoints, too. A look at some of the recommended places surrounding Haridwar follows:

1. Rishikesh

A few hours’ drive from Haridwar is the town of Rishikesh, popular as the “Yoga Capital of the World.” Laid-back, far from the maddening crowd, along with beautiful landscapes full of multiple ashrams and yoga retreats, this town pampers everyone. The adventure thrills of white-water rafting and trekking in Rishikesh make it perfect to opt for during a day trip.

2. Rajaji National Park

This place is a paradise for bird watchers as well. It is home to huge numbers of flora and fauna, such as elephants, tigers, and leopards. The rich habitat of this park can be seen by taking a safari tour.

3. Dehradun

The capital of Uttarakhand, Dehradun, is about an hour away from Haridwar by road. It has the attractions of Robber’s Cave, Sahastradhara, and the Mindrolling Monastery. Dehradun’s weather is pleasant and beautiful.
